BWU reports 73 women killed in August due to Myanmar junta attacks

by Admin | Sep 9, 2025 | Daily News, Massacre

Source: Mizzima | Report

According to the report, 54 women were killed in aerial bombardments, seven by artillery shelling, three were burned to death, and one died due to sexual violence. Among the victims, 14 were minors under the age of 18.
